Output e787d84aede2eeb0c0c5220e3a58437f7141d8e3926489668cb665e72597d04e:2

value
25950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54848516ac8a0dd40699da16ebe95b5b1a4cec5f OP_EQUAL
address
39PuSJMTBqdfdfA1Ho7yHcDzcB7me5pywX
transaction
e787d84aede2eeb0c0c5220e3a58437f7141d8e3926489668cb665e72597d04e
confirmations
481673
spent
true